HC Deb 09 December 1963 vol 686 c178

[Queen's Recommendation signified]

Considered in Committee under Standing Order No. 88 (Money Committees).

[SIR WILLIAM ANSTRUTHER-GRAY in the Chair]

Resolved, That, for the purposes of any Act of the present Sessior to provide for the payment out of the legal aid funds of costs incurred by successful opponents of legally aided litigants, it is expedient to authorise the payment out of moneys provided by Parliament of the sums required to meet any increased charge falling on the Legal Aid Fund or the Legal Aid (Scotland) Fund by reason of any provision of the said Act enabling a court which decides proceedings against a legally aided party and in favour of a party not receiving legal aid to order the payment out of the appropriate legal aid fund of costs incurred in those proceedings by the party not receiving legal aid.—[The, Attorney-General.]

Resolution to be reported.

Report to be received upon Monday next.
